Heim >Backend-Entwicklung >PHP-Tutorial >Schwerwiegender Fehler: require(): Fehler beim Öffnen der erforderlichen Datei „data/tdk.php' behoben

Schwerwiegender Fehler: require(): Fehler beim Öffnen der erforderlichen Datei „data/tdk.php' behoben

WBOY
WBOYOriginal
2023-11-27 11:40:59897Durchsuche

fatal error: require(): Failed opening required 'data/tdk.php'错误的修复方法

Schwerwiegender Fehler: require(): Fehler beim Öffnen der erforderlichen Fehlerreparaturmethode „data/tdk.php“

Bei der Website-Entwicklung oder -Wartung stoßen wir häufig auf verschiedene Fehler. Einer der häufigsten Fehler ist „Schwerwiegender Fehler: require(): Fehler beim Öffnen der erforderlichen Datei ‚data/tdk.php‘“. Dieser Fehler wird normalerweise durch ein Problem mit dem Dateipfad oder der Datei selbst verursacht. In diesem Artikel behandeln wir einige häufige Korrekturen, die Ihnen bei der Behebung dieses Problems helfen sollen.

Zuerst müssen wir die Ursache dieses Fehlers verstehen. In PHP wird die Funktion require() verwendet, um eine angegebene Datei einzubinden. Wenn die Datei nicht existiert oder der Pfad falsch ist, wird ein Fehler gemeldet. Wenn wir daher den Fehler „Schwerwiegender Fehler: require(): Fehler beim Öffnen der erforderlichen ‚data/tdk.php‘“ sehen, bedeutet dies, dass PHP die Datei tdk.php im angegebenen Pfad nicht finden kann.

Als nächstes können wir die folgenden Schritte ausführen, um dieses Problem zu beheben:

  1. Überprüfen Sie, ob der Pfad korrekt ist: Zuerst müssen wir bestätigen, ob der Pfad korrekt ist. Stellen Sie sicher, dass die Datei data/tdk.php im angegebenen Pfad vorhanden ist. Wenn die Datei nicht existiert oder der Pfad falsch ist, müssen wir den Dateipfad in der Funktion require() aktualisieren.
  2. Überprüfen Sie die Dateiberechtigungen: Manchmal können auch Dateiberechtigungsprobleme diesen Fehler verursachen. Bitte stellen Sie sicher, dass die Datei data/tdk.php über Leseberechtigungen verfügt. Sie können Dateiberechtigungen ändern, indem Sie den Befehl chmod 644 data/tdk.php ausführen.
  3. Überprüfen Sie die Groß-/Kleinschreibung von Dateinamen: In einigen Betriebssystemen wird bei Dateinamen die Groß-/Kleinschreibung beachtet. Bitte stellen Sie sicher, dass die Groß-/Kleinschreibung des Dateinamens mit der in der Funktion require() übereinstimmt. Wenn der Dateiname beispielsweise tdk.php lautet und die Funktion require() als TDK.PHP geschrieben ist, wird die Fehlermeldung „Datei nicht gefunden“ angezeigt.
  4. Überprüfen Sie die Dateikodierung: Manchmal kann auch das Kodierungsformat der Datei diesen Fehler verursachen. Bitte stellen Sie sicher, dass das Codierungsformat der Datei data/tdk.php UTF-8 ist und keine anderen Formate. Sie können die Kodierung der Datei über einen Texteditor in UTF-8 ändern.

Die oben genannten sind einige gängige Methoden zur Behebung des Fehlers „Schwerwiegender Fehler: require(): Fehler beim Öffnen der erforderlichen Datei ‚data/tdk.php‘“. Wenn Sie das Problem nach den oben genannten Schritten immer noch nicht gelöst haben, können Sie die folgenden zusätzlichen Methoden ausprobieren:

  1. Überprüfen Sie, ob die Datei an einem anderen Speicherort vorhanden ist: Manchmal kann es vorkommen, dass wir die Datei versehentlich an einem anderen Speicherort ablegen, was dazu führt, dass sie nicht vorhanden ist gefunden werden. Bitte stellen Sie sicher, dass die Datei data/tdk.php am richtigen Speicherort vorhanden ist. Sie können einen Dateimanager oder ein Befehlszeilentool verwenden, um die Datei zu finden.
  2. Überprüfen Sie, wie auf Dateien verwiesen wird: Manchmal verweisen wir versehentlich mehrmals auf dieselbe Datei im Code, was zu falschen Dateipfaden führt. Bitte überprüfen Sie, ob Ihr Code dieselbe Funktion require() enthält, und stellen Sie in diesem Fall sicher, dass der Pfad korrekt ist.

Zusammenfassung:

Der Fehler „Schwerwiegender Fehler: require(): Fehler beim Öffnen der erforderlichen Datei ‚data/tdk.php‘“ ist ein relativ häufiger PHP-Fehler, der normalerweise durch Probleme mit dem Dateipfad oder der Datei selbst verursacht wird. Um diesen Fehler zu beheben, müssen wir zunächst prüfen, ob der Pfad korrekt ist, sicherstellen, dass die Datei über die richtigen Berechtigungen verfügt, und auf die Groß-/Kleinschreibung und das Codierungsformat des Dateinamens achten. Wenn das Problem weiterhin besteht, können Sie weiter prüfen, ob die Datei an anderer Stelle vorhanden ist oder ob doppelte Verweise im Code vorhanden sind.
Ich hoffe, dass die oben genannten Methoden Ihnen helfen können, diesen Fehler zu beheben und den normalen Betrieb Ihrer Website zu ermöglichen.

Das obige ist der detaillierte Inhalt vonSchwerwiegender Fehler: require(): Fehler beim Öffnen der erforderlichen Datei „data/tdk.php' behoben.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n